i suspect there will only be one pin for Fuse 12. Fuse 16 is for the heated mirrors which is spliced off pre-fuse inside the fuse box. However if there is one pin for Fuse 12 you should be able to put a pin in the other side providing it's live which it should be when the heated mirrors are one which is all the time the engine is running.
